skittish

adjective
/ˈskɪtɪʃ/

Meaning

easily frightened or nervous; unpredictable

Example Sentences

The horse was too skittish to ride.

Synonyms

nervous, jumpy, restless, excitable, unpredictable

Antonyms

calm, steady

Collocations

skittish horse, skittish investor, skittish behavior
